    people reveal their true selves with the words they choose to type.
    not all the time. I have been surfing many CMA forums in China, Taiwan, and south east Asia.

    Usually, everyone knows about everyone. so most of the time, posters are just joking around.

    for example, if a thread started with some questions, then answers are usually citing a link to a valid source. whatever you say without a verifiable good source will not be taken seriously.

    if you said something about what you think, then the next post will be derailing it. such as have you eaten upstairs? are you hungry? I am cooking instant noodle, you may come.

    previous post is considered upstairs to the current post. or tai shang.

    the forum board is like a high building/hotel. moderators are called the owner of the building or lou zhu.

    there is no noodle. it is simply an invitation to come over to my place and prove what you just said by exchanging hands. or meet in person then we discuss.

    then you may respond by yes, I am coming, I will bring some wine and snacks (meaning friends).

    good we are waiting for you.

    ---

    they are all mature and serious about their posts.

    --

    if one backs down, then his talks/posts will be ignored in the future.

    --

    several weeks later, both may come back and post that they both have a good time over the weekend. the noodle is good, the wine and snacks are good, too. meaning they both get aquainted in person.
